Join us for an insightful conversation with Batu Sener, the talented composer behind Better Man, Harold and the Purple Crayon, and Ice Age: The Adventures of Buck Wild. Batu has collaborated extensively with Oscar-nominated composer John Powell, contributing to some of cinema’s most iconic scores. His work includes additional music for Wicked, an Oscar-nominated score, as well as contributions to How to Train Your Dragon: The Hidden World and Solo: A Star Wars Story.
In this episode, Batu takes us behind the scenes of his incredible journey as a composer, from working at the renowned 5 Cat Studios in collaboration with John Powell to developing his own scores. We explore the art of composing across genres, from family adventures to musicals, and the unique challenges and joys of projects like Better Man and Wicked.
We also delve into the importance of a composer as a storyteller, uncovering how music enhances the emotional core of a film and connects audiences to the story on screen.
